Participez aux premiers tests de Storage Partitioning.

Découvrez comment vérifier si votre site est concerné par Storage Partitioning.

Pour améliorer la confidentialité, Chrome va modifier le comportement des API de stockage et de communication dans les prochaines versions. Apprenez-en plus sur le changement à venir concernant le partitionnement du stockage.

L'implémentation initiale est disponible derrière un indicateur dans Chrome 105 depuis juillet 2022. À partir de la version bêta 106 de Chrome, la nouvelle implémentation (qui inclut le partitionnement du stockage du cache) est disponible à des fins de test à partir de septembre 2022. Les dernières fonctionnalités et corrections de bugs seront disponibles en premier dans Chrome Canary. Nous vous conseillons donc d'utiliser Canary pour poursuivre les tests.

Cette modification ne devrait pas affecter les cas d'utilisation les plus courants où votre application n'utilise l'espace de stockage que dans un contexte propriétaire. Toutefois, nous vous recommandons d'effectuer des tests pour vous assurer que vos applications continueront de fonctionner comme actuellement. Si vous interagissez avec des iFrames ou si vous utilisez un stockage dans des cadres iFrame, vous avez plus de chances que ce changement vous impacte.

Tester le partitionnement du stockage

Pour essayer Storage Partitioning, procédez comme suit:

  1. Vérifiez que vous utilisez la version bêta 106 ou une version ultérieure de Chrome.
  2. Accédez à chrome://flags/#third-party-storage-partitioning.
  3. Activez l'option "Experimental Third-party Storage Partitioning" (Partitionnement du stockage tiers expérimental).

Participez aux premiers tests et signalez des bugs pour aider l'équipe Chrome à identifier et à corriger tout comportement inattendu avant le lancement de la version stable.

Qu'est-ce que Storage Partitioning ?

Pour empêcher certains types de suivi intersites sur canal secondaire, Chrome partitionne les API de stockage et de communication dans des contextes tiers (voir l'explication pour plus de détails).

Auparavant, le stockage n'était associé qu'à l'origine. Cela signifie que si un iFrame de example.com est intégré à a.com et b.com, example.com peut connaître vos habitudes de navigation sur ces deux sites de premier niveau en stockant un ID dans l'espace de stockage et en le récupérant. Lorsque le partitionnement du stockage tiers est activé, le stockage de example.com existe dans deux partitions différentes, l'une pour a.com et l'autre pour b.com. Le partitionnement du stockage empêche une intégration de joindre vos visites sur l'un ou l'autre des sites.

Les API de stockage et de communication suivantes sont partitionnées lorsque vous activez l'option "Experimental Third-party Storage Partitioning" (Partitionnement du stockage tiers en version expérimentale) :

Les API suivantes sont en cours de développement et seront partitionnées avant d'être distribuées en version stable:

  • URL du blob
  • En-tête Effacer les données du site

Quand cette fonctionnalité sera-t-elle lancée par défaut ?

Nous espérons lancer le lancement de cette fonctionnalité début 2023 en fonction de sa stabilité et de sa compatibilité. Tester le partitionnement du stockage tiers et signaler des bugs aidera Chrome à recueillir les commentaires de l'écosystème pour s'assurer que les développeurs et les propriétaires de sites bénéficient de l'assistance dont ils ont besoin.

Signaler des bugs

Le meilleur moyen de nous faire part de vos commentaires consiste à signaler un nouveau problème par le biais d'un lien vers une URL accessible au public ou d'un scénario de test réduit.